Apple says it is releasing updates early in response to AI cybersecurity concerns
AI Summary

Apple is accelerating its software update schedule to release security patches faster than its traditional bundled release cycle. This shift is a direct response to the increased speed at which AI-driven tools allow hackers to exploit software vulnerabilities.

Why it matters

This change reflects a broader industry trend where companies must prioritize rapid security deployment to counter the evolving threat landscape posed by AI-enhanced cyberattacks.

Apple said it is pushing forward a series of ​software updates that would previously have been bundled ‌with a new version of its ​iOS operating system , making them available ⁠earlier than in previous cycles in response to AI-driven security concerns.
